Hermann Lismann was a German painter known for his contributions to the Expressionist movement in the early 20th century. One of his notable works is "Frauenakt im Profil nach links," which translates to "Female Nude in Profile Facing Left." This painting exemplifies Lismann's skill in capturing the human form with a distinct expressionist flair, focusing on the emotional and psychological depth of his subjects.

Lismann was born in 1878 in Germany and studied art in various European cities, including Munich and Paris. His exposure to different art movements and styles during his studies significantly influenced his artistic development. The Expressionist movement, characterized by its emphasis on representing emotional experiences rather than physical reality, resonated with Lismann, and he became associated with this style.

"Frauenakt im Profil nach links" is a testament to Lismann's ability to blend traditional techniques with modernist sensibilities. The painting features a female figure depicted in profile, facing left. The use of bold lines and dynamic brushstrokes is typical of Expressionism, aiming to convey the inner emotions of the subject rather than focusing solely on anatomical accuracy. The color palette is often subdued yet striking, with contrasts that highlight the contours and features of the figure.

Lismann's work often explored themes of identity, emotion, and the human condition, and "Frauenakt im Profil nach links" is no exception. The choice of a nude subject allows for an exploration of vulnerability and strength, a common theme in Expressionist art. The profile view adds a layer of introspection, inviting the viewer to ponder the thoughts and feelings of the subject.

Throughout his career, Lismann faced numerous challenges, particularly due to the political climate in Germany. As a Jewish artist during the rise of the Nazi regime, Lismann's work was labeled as "degenerate art," a term used by the Nazis to denigrate modernist styles that did not align with their ideology. This classification led to the confiscation and destruction of many artworks by Lismann and his contemporaries. Despite these challenges, Lismann continued to create and contribute to the art world, leaving behind a legacy that is appreciated for its emotional depth and technical skill.

"Frauenakt im Profil nach links" remains an important piece within Lismann's oeuvre, reflecting both the personal and broader historical contexts in which it was created. The painting is a reminder of the resilience of artists who, despite facing persecution and adversity, continued to express their vision and contribute to the cultural landscape.

Today, Lismann's works are studied and appreciated for their contribution to Expressionism and their poignant reflection of the human experience. "Frauenakt im Profil nach links" is a significant example of how art can transcend its time, offering insights into both the artist's personal journey and the broader societal issues of the era.
